Output 75cb59a3f87c7a3631a4ba693a55bdb09a78cc04f234adb9956b61dc19a90815:0

value
369434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dcb26de62da5a068d8381e103b87bf5397caa01 OP_EQUAL
address
34QYtLsnZxvSqmQcHJ2x26ViAD64vWik8W
transaction
75cb59a3f87c7a3631a4ba693a55bdb09a78cc04f234adb9956b61dc19a90815